Abstract
The invention discloses a fireproof heat-insulation reinforced needled felt, which comprises: a base cloth layer; and reinforcing layers positioned at two sides of the base cloth layer; and a fireproof heat-insulating layer positioned on the surface of the reinforcing layer; the reinforced layer comprises a reinforced net, the fireproof heat-insulating layer comprises glass fiber acupuncture cotton and ceramic fiber cotton, and the glass fiber acupuncture cotton and the ceramic fiber cotton are mutually interwoven. The reinforced fireproof heat-insulation needled felt provided by the invention mainly comprises a base cloth layer, a reinforcing layer, a fireproof heat-insulation layer and the like, wherein the reinforcing layer is mainly woven by warps and wefts formed by a base line and glass fiber wires, the glass fiber wires are made of high-temperature-resistant high-strength and superfine flexible glass fibers through special processing, the strength of the needled felt can be improved, and the high-temperature-resistant coating is arranged on the surface of the needled felt, so that the high-temperature-resistant performance of the needled felt is improved; the fireproof heat-insulating layer is formed by interweaving glass fiber needled cotton and ceramic fiber cotton, and the glass fiber needled cotton and the ceramic fiber cotton are both made of high-temperature-resistant materials, so that the fireproof heat-insulating effect of the needled felt can be effectively improved.

Technical Field
The invention belongs to the technical field of needled felts, and particularly relates to a fireproof heat-insulation reinforced needled felt.
Background
The glass fiber needled felt is a filtering material with reasonable structure and good performance, which takes glass fiber as raw material, needles the carded chopped glass fiber felt by using a needle, and entangles the fibers among the glass fibers of the felt layer and between the glass fibers of the felt layer and the reinforcing glass fiber base cloth by a mechanical method, so that a fiber web is reinforced to prepare the felt-shaped non-woven fabric filtering material.
However, the high temperature resistance of the glass fiber needled felt is poor, the glass fiber becomes fragile under the high temperature condition, the pressure resistance is greatly reduced, the internal fracture and damage of the glass fiber needled felt are easily caused, the normal use of the glass fiber needled felt is influenced, the needled felt in the current market is various in variety, the oxidation is easily generated due to the long-term exposure to high temperature and air, and the consumption of the needled felt is fast due to the soft structural material and the abrasion, and the fireproof heat resistance is poor.

Example 1
The invention provides a fireproof heat-insulation reinforced needled felt as shown in figures 1-5, which comprises: a base fabric layer 1; and the reinforcing layers 2 are positioned at two sides of the base cloth layer 1; and a fireproof heat-insulating layer 3 positioned on the surface of the reinforcing layer 2.
Specifically, through add enhancement layer 2 and fire prevention insulating layer 3 on the base cloth of traditional acupuncture felt, enhancement layer 2 can improve the tensile effect of acupuncture felt, improves its bulk strength, does benefit to the life who improves acupuncture felt, and fire prevention insulating layer 3 can strengthen the heat-resisting characteristic of fire prevention of acupuncture felt for acupuncture felt accommodation is more extensive, and life is longer.
Further, the reinforcing layer 2 comprises a reinforcing mesh 201, the reinforcing mesh 201 is formed by weaving warps 202 and wefts 203, and the surfaces of the warps 202 and the wefts 203 are provided with high-temperature resistant coatings 204; the refractory coating 204 includes: a bottom layer 205 and a face layer 206; the bottom layer 205 is coated on the surface of the warp 202 and weft 203, and the top layer 206 is coated on the surface of the bottom layer 205. The warp 202 and the weft 203 each include: a base wire 207 and a glass fiber thread 208, the glass fiber thread 208 is wrapped outside the base wire 207.
The warp 202 and the weft 203 are coated with the wrapping high-temperature-resistant coating 204, so that the fireproof and heat-resistant effects of the reinforcing mesh 201 are improved, and meanwhile, the glass fiber wire 208 is made of high-temperature-resistant high-strength and superfine flexible glass fibers through a special process, so that the strength of the needled felt can be improved.
In addition, the bottom layer 205 is an adhesive, and the surface layer 206 is a high temperature resistant paint layer, and the adhesive is beneficial for the high temperature resistant paint layer to adhere to the surfaces of the base line 207 and the glass fiber line 208.
The high-temperature-resistant paint layer comprises the following components in percentage by mass: 50% of organic silicon resin, 5% of nano silicon dioxide, 3% of silicate, 4% of special additive dispersant and the balance of water.
The fireproof heat insulation layer 3 comprises glass fiber punched cotton 301 and ceramic fiber cotton 302, and the glass fiber punched cotton 301 and the ceramic fiber cotton 302 are interwoven with each other. Both are high temperature resistant materials, and can effectively improve the fireproof and heat insulation effects of the needled felt.

Example 4
As shown in fig. 6 to 8, in processing the high temperature resistant paint layer, the following coating assembly is used, which includes: pay-off machine 4, coating case 5 and admission machine 6, pay-off machine 4 and admission machine 6 are located the both sides of coating case 5. Wherein, paying out machine 4 is used for placing the coil of wire, and coating case 5 is used for coating high temperature resistant lacquer layer, and admission machine 6 is used for the rolling wire rod.
Further, be equipped with storage case 501 and stoving case 502 in the inside of coating case 5, storage case 501 is located and is close to 4 one ends of paying out machine, and stoving case 502 is located and is close to the one end of admission machine 6. The storage box 501 is used for placing high-temperature-resistant paint, and the drying box 502 is used for drying a paint layer on a wire rod.
Specifically, the storage box 501 and the drying box 502 have an inlet 503 and an outlet 504 respectively formed on two sides thereof for the wires to pass in and out, guide wheels 505 are rotatably mounted in the inlet 503 and the outlet 504 to assist in wire transmission and prevent the wires from shifting, and paint scraping members 506 are mounted in the outlet 504 to scrape off redundant paint. In addition, the bottom of the storage tank 501 is also provided with a guide wheel 505.
The painting member 506 includes: a conical head 507 and a scraping ring 508 connected with the end part of the conical head 507; wherein, the conical head 507 is provided with a hollow structure. The lower end of conical head 507 communicates with outlet 504, does benefit to the lacquer backward flow after scraping to storage case 501.
The inside of stoving case 502 is installed and is installed electric heating pipe 509, is connected with the temperature controller on the electric heating pipe 509, and the top intercommunication of stoving case 502 has exhaust pipe 510, and the last intercommunication of exhaust pipe 510 has exhaust fan 511.
Specifically, after the wire rod coats the lacquer layer in storage case 501, can spread in scraping ring 508, scrape ring 508 and can scrape unnecessary lacquer on the wire rod and flow back to storage case 501 in, the wire rod after the coating is dried to the lacquer layer by electric heating pipe 509 in the inside of stoving case 502, and exhaust fan 511 discharges steam through exhaust pipe 510, has made things convenient for the coating on high temperature resistant lacquer layer.
